“I told you vampires often turn on those they love the most”…… watch the promo for the last 3 episodes of True Blood season 5….. it’s going to be an explosive season finale……
source: Youtube WatchPromos
“I told you vampires often turn on those they love the most”…… watch the promo for the last 3 episodes of True Blood season 5….. it’s going to be an explosive season finale……
source: Youtube WatchPromos